Protect CI runners from disk space over consumption
This job was regularly killing kubernetes CI runners because cta-taped
process kept generating large core dump files until the runner disk was full.
Some protections need to be put in place to prevent this disk explosion
as after this the runner is not usable anymore with the current setup:

In order to protect the runners we should make sure that /var/lib/containers
is not growing too large and/or put quotas on kubernetes
managed volumes (problem is that this could cause trouble for stress tests).
